My first project features the Make-a-Monster die set and the Monster Hugs die set. They are both so much fun to play with! They can be used individually to make a million and one creations. Seriously, the possibilities are endless!

For this fun card, I ink blended a panel and then die cut all my pieces from colored cardstock. I used my copics on the colored cardstock to add some shadows to my monster but not much. I love this guy! I could totally handle a squishy hug from him! Couldn’t you?

Next, I just had to play with my Zigs and watercolor this fabulous floral image from the new Love You Bunches stamp set. After coloring, I die cut the image and set to make my card. I splattered black acrylic paint on a white card base and then heat embossed my sentiment on the black banner. I popped all the layers up with foam tape and added some fun twine to the top. My final card share for today features the Heart Burst stencil set, the Love and Stuff Sentiments and the Bold Love dies. These are some of my favorites from this release and I had so much fun putting them all together.
To create this card I inked up a panel with picked raspberry and worn lipstick, spritzed with water and then layered my stencil adding the same colors over the top. I love how it turned out! I cut the panel down, stamped my sentiment and popped it up with foam tape.
Next I die cut my letters from cardstock and craft foam and layered them all together. Then I glued them above the stenciled panel and finished this fun card off with some Boiled Sugar Jelly Hearts.
